      I lost my dad to pancreatic cancer in July 2004, when I was 17. He passed away just 5 weeks after his official diagnosis. He tried chemotherapy but that did more harm than good. So he decided to stop all treatments and that was it. I was by his side when he died. 3 1/2 years later, the the pain of losing him is still very much with me.

      Treatments

      Crying Working / Worked
      Usually makes me feel better, allows me to get my feelings out.
    • Close Bereavement
      Type: Loss of a Parent

      I lost my dad to pancreatic cancer in July 2004. It's been a challenge...just hoping to meet some people who have also experienced the loss of a parent. Also, I lost my grandma and great-aunt (both on dad's side) the following year. I'm left with only one aunt and an estranged half brother, both of whom I have little contact with. I really have no one on that side of my family.

      Treatments

      Crying Working / Worked
      Getting Angry Working / Worked
      Keeping Busy Somewhat Helpful
      Music Somewhat Helpful
      Certain songs remind me of my Dad, which can be really comforting. Other sad songs let me cry my emotions out. Faster, upbeat songs allow me to dance like no one's watching.
      Pets Working / Worked
      My babies are always there to talk to, play with and cuddle with.
      Remembering Working / Worked
      Sometimes this makes me feel 100% better, and other times it makes me completely angry. Remembering good times may be a good thing, but I get angry that I can't have more.
      Support from Friends & Family Somewhat Helpful
      Mom and sister are always there to lean on. Most of the time talking to them makes me feel better, though sometimes they just don't understand how/what I'm feeling.
      Talking Somewhat Helpful
      Time Not Working
      Those who say time heals all wounds are completely wrong.
